- Marie_Carré abstract "Marie Carré (died 1984) was a French Protestant nurse who later in life converted to become a Roman Catholic nun. She is known primarily for having published a purported memoir entitled AA-1025: The Memoirs of an Anti-Apostle, which some consider to be Traditionalist Catholic propaganda.".
